What are Certified Roofers and Why Do They Matter in Marysville?

A certified roofer is more than just a contractor with a basic business license. While a license is a legal requirement to operate in Washington, manufacturer certification is an earned badge of excellence. Industry leaders like GAF or Owens Corning only certify contractors who pass rigorous vetting processes. These certified roofers must demonstrate financial stability, carry specific insurance levels, and undergo constant training on the latest installation techniques. In Marysville, where the weather can shift from bright sun to heavy downpours in minutes, these standards are vital for your home's safety.

Sticking to local building codes is the bare minimum for any construction project. Certified professionals go beyond these legal baselines to provide a system that survives the Pacific Northwest. The Hidden Cost of "Cheap" Roofing

A "bargain" roof often fails because of invisible mistakes. Poor nailing patterns, like using only 3 nails per shingle instead of the 6 required for high-wind zones, cause shingles to lift during winter storms. We frequently see roofs that should last 25 years fail in under 5 years due to trapped heat from bad ventilation. Spotting "Storm Chasers" in Marysville

When a storm hits Snohomish County, "storm chasers" often arrive from out of state. These contractors lack local roots and the specific certifications needed for Washington homes. Before signing anything, verify their status with the Washington State Department of Labor & Industries. This ensures they meet the legal requirements for bonding and insurance. Red flags include high-pressure sales, asking for full payment upfront, or unmarked vehicles. Professional teams will always show their credentials and provide a clear, written estimate. Managing PNW Moisture and Algae

Constant dampness in Western Washington leads to mold and wood rot if your roof isn't built as a complete system. Certified systems include high-performance synthetic underlayment that acts as a secondary water barrier. We also prioritize attic ventilation. Stagnant air trapped in your attic can reach 150 degrees in the summer, which bakes your shingles from the inside out. Our "Master" installations include ridge vents and soffit intakes to keep air moving year-round. We also use shingles with specialized algae-resistance technology. These shingles use copper ions to prevent the "green roof" look common in Snohomish County. This keeps your home looking sharp and prevents organic growth from eating away at your shingles.

Superior Protection Against Wind and Rain

Puget Sound storms often bring wind gusts exceeding 60 mph. Certified installation prevents wind uplift by using specific six-nail patterns and high-bond sealants. We ensure every shingle strip activates correctly to create a monolithic shield against the elements. Drip edge installation is another non-negotiable step for us. This metal flashing prevents water from wicking into your roof deck or rotting your fascia boards. What is the difference between a licensed roofer and a certified roofer?

Licensing is a legal requirement from the state, while certification is an extra credential from manufacturers. In Washington, all contractors must have a license through the Department of Labor & Industries. Certified roofers go beyond this by meeting strict manufacturer standards for installation quality and training. This ensures your Marysville home gets a higher level of expert service. Will a manufacturer warranty cover my roof if I use an uncertified contractor?

A standard manufacturer warranty typically only covers material defects, not installation errors. If an uncertified contractor installs your shingles incorrectly, the manufacturer can void your warranty entirely. How can I verify if a roofer in Marysville is actually certified?

You can verify a roofer’s status by checking the manufacturer’s official website or asking for their unique certification ID number. For example, GAF and Owens Corning maintain online directories of their factory-certified contractors.
